I noticed that clickhouse config.xml seems to not include error_log, latency_log, query_views_log, processors_profile_log, which all cause a LOT more CPU usage than needed. I recently disabled them for my own install and noticed much improved performance. Did they slip through when they got introduced recently ? Seems clickhouse config.xml hasn't seen an update in quite some time, but I'm asking since there may be a reason to this.
